IDAHO FALLS, ID -- Patricia Jean Mills Westergard, 67, of Idaho Falls, passed away September 16, 2009, at Eastern Idaho Regional Medical Center from a sudden heart attack.
She was born January 24, 1942 in Idaho Falls to William Howard Mills and Ruby Elva Emerick Mills. She attended Lincoln Elementary School, and graduated from Bonneville High School in 1960. After high school, she attended Links Business School in Boise.
On August 18, 1962, Jean married James C. Westergard III, the love of her life, at the Trinity United Methodist Church. Together they raised three children: Janie, David and Lynett. She was a life long resident of Idaho Falls.
From 1980 to 2002, she owned and operated Sassy Seconds Boutique, a popular consignment boutique near downtown Idaho Falls. From 1997 - 2002 she also ran Overtime Sports.
Jean was an excellent business woman that contributed a lot to the community through her store. She also enjoyed shopping, home decorating, playing the piano, singing, reading, making flower arrangements, knitting, gardening, and especially loved spending time with her family and friends.
She was a wonderful wife, mother, sister and friend and will be dearly missed by us all.
